Public hearing

After a one-month public consultation period from January 16 to February 14, a Public Hearing took place on February 27 in Lümanda, Saaremaa Parish, gathering about 60 people.

February 27th, Lümanda, Saaremaa Parish, Estonia.

This event allowed us to get inputs from local communities, government agencies, NGOs, and private citizens to leverage many aspects of the project.
